Setting Up Find My iPhone
Syncing with iCloud:
Start by ensuring your iPhone is connected to your iCloud account.
Go to Settings > [Your Name] > iCloud and enable Find My iPhone.
Enabling Location Services:
Accurate tracking relies on Location Services.
Navigate to Settings > Privacy > Location Services and ensure they're turned on.
A Step By Step Guide For Finding Your iPhone
Step1: Accessing Find My iPhone:
Launch the "Find My" app on another Apple device or access it via iCloud.com using your Apple ID.
Step2: Locating Your Device:
Inside the "Find My" app, tap on "Devices" to open a map displaying the locations of your registered Apple devices.
On iCloud.com, click "All Devices" and select the specific device you're trying to locate.
Step3: Playing a Sound:
If you suspect your iPhone is nearby, use the "Play Sound" feature to trigger an audible sound, even if your device is in silent mode.
Step4: Activating Lost Mode:
Lost Mode is your ally in device security. Activate it to set a passcode and display a personalized message on the screen, aiding anyone who discovers your device. Lost Mode also provides insights into the device's movements.
Step5: Erasing Data:
In dire situations where recovery seems unlikely, the option to remotely erase all data ensures the confidentiality of your sensitive information.
Step6: Activation Lock:
Fortify your device's security by enabling Activation Lock. This feature ensures that even if a thief attempts to reset your device, they would need your Apple ID and password to gain access.
Strategies for a Successful Search
Timely Action: Swift action is critical. Initiate the tracking process as soon as you realize your iPhone is missing, maximizing the chances of successful recovery.
Secure Access: Only use trusted Apple devices or secure web browsers to access "Find My iPhone," ensuring the safety of your data.
Enhance iCloud Security: Strengthen your iCloud account's security by using a strong, unique password to prevent unauthorized access.
